答:MySQL是一款非常常用的關系型數據庫管理系統,很多時候我們需要在不同的機器上遠程訪問MySQL數據庫。但是默認情況下,MySQL只允許本地訪問,如果想要遠程訪問MySQL,需要進行一些配置。
以下是詳細的MySQL遠程連接配置方法:
1. 修改MySQL配置文件
yfysqld-address屬性,將其注釋掉或將其值改為0.0.0.0,表示允許任何IP地址訪問MySQL服務器。
2. 創建遠程訪問用戶
在MySQL服務器上創建一個允許遠程訪問的用戶,可以使用以下命令:
```ame'@'%' IDENTIFIED BY 'password';
ame和password分別為你要創建的用戶名和密碼。
3. 授予用戶訪問權限
為了讓該用戶可以訪問MySQL服務器,需要為其授予訪問權限。可以使用以下命令:
```ame'@'%';
其中,*.*表示授予該用戶對任何數據庫和表的訪問權限。
4. 重載MySQL配置
完成以上步驟后,需要重載MySQL的配置,使其生效。可以使用以下命令:
FLUSH PRIVILEGES;
至此,MySQL遠程連接的配置就完成了。現在你可以在另一臺機器上使用MySQL客戶端連接到該服務器了。
需要注意的是,為了保證安全性,建議在創建遠程訪問用戶時,僅授予其必要的訪問權限,避免不必要的風險。同時,建議使用較為復雜的密碼,提高安全性。